BCCI Construction Company in Claremore, Oklahoma is seeking an Onboarding Coordinator responsible for ensuring a smooth onboarding process for new hires. This role serves as the first point of contact, coordinating with HR and project teams to create a positive experience while adhering to safety standards.
Key responsibilities include managing onboarding sessions, developing standardized processes, and collaborating with hiring managers to improve onboarding efficiency. The ideal candidate has 2+ years of experience in HR coordination and strong organizational skills.
The Onboarding Coordinator is responsible for managing and facilitating the new hire onboarding process to ensure a smooth, compliant, and engaging transition into the company and the jobsite. This role serves as the first point of contact for new employees as they arrive on the jobsite, creating a positive introduction to the organization and project while ensuring adherence to company, client, and project‑specific requirements. The Onboarding Coordinator partners with Human Resources, project teams, and leadership to standardize onboarding processes, reinforce safety and security standards, and support workforce integration into Layton’s Mission Critical business unit.
